One way to help avoid memory is to cultivate many meaningful relationships. Research shows that spending even a few hours every week with your family members or other people who are close to you strengthens the area of the brain involved in memory.
If you struggle to remember a new person’s name, associate them with a person you already know that has the same name. You can also make the mental association with those of a celebrity.
Focus only on the topic you when you are memorizing information. Humans need to store items to be remembered in their long-term memory before they can easily remember it. It’s hard to do this effectively if you don’t give it your full attention.
Mnemonic devices can help you remember something important. This strategy involves learning to pair a topic you know well with something you need to remember.

If you keep your body fit by working out, you’ll increase the capability of your brain to remember things, and be able to remember any information you have gotten. Exercise also increases the amount of oxygen that goes to the brain, keeping it healthy and staving off problems that cause memory loss. Exercise can activate chemicals that are essential for protecting the cells located in your brain.
This is a great tip that can help you retain new information. If you need to remember something new, try associating it with something that is familiar to you. By creating a connection between new data and things already learned, you are making the most of an already familiar concept.
